1 cup Greek yogurt
8 oz light cream cheese, softened
½ cup vanilla or plain protein powder
2–3 tablespoons sweetener of choice (stevia, honey, or maple syrup)
2 e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Preheat oven to 325°F (165°C).
Prepare muffin tin: Lightly grease or line with cupcake liners.
Mix ingredients: In a mixing bowl, whisk together Greek yogurt, cream cheese, protein powder, eggs, sweetener, and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y.
Fill the muffin tin: Pour the mixture into the prepared muffin cups, filling each about ¾ full.
Bake for 18–20 minutes, or until centers are set but still slightly jiggly.
Cool and chill: Let the cheesecakes cool for 10 minutes at room temperature,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ours.
Serve: Enjoy chilled, topped with fresh berries, chocolate drizzle, or a spoonful of nut butter.
Chocolate Chip: Stir in mini chocolate chips before baking.
Berry Swirl: Add a swirl of raspberry or strawberry puree on top before baking.
Cinnamon Spice: Mix in cinnamon and a pinch of nutmeg for a warm, cozy variation.
